kami ad074cea31 Swap the resident model without restarting mavend (#250)
Loading a different gguf was a one-line edit to phraser.model_path plus a
restart. It is now an owner-triggered IPC call, off unless configured.

internal/phraser/swap.go holds the safety properties as code:

  - Never two models resident. The old llama-server is killed and reaped
    before the new one is launched. One 1.7B fits the Vega iGPU; a
    blue/green overlap would OOM the box, so it is not offered.
  - Atomic from a turn's point of view. Swap drains the in-flight turns
    (they finish on the old model), then refuses arrivals with ErrSwapping
    until the new server has answered /v1/models. No turn ever sees half a
    swap; refused turns fall back to the classifier cascade.
  - A failed load rolls back. If the new model does not start or does not
    probe, the previous one is reloaded and the call returns RolledBack
    with the error. If the rollback also fails the daemon says so and
    degrades to the classifier rather than pretending to serve.

Holders of the completion client are re-pointed, not rebuilt: llm.Client
guards its base URL and LLMPhraser.OnSwap re-points it, so the router, the
replier, the mail extractor and the memory evaluator follow the new port
without knowing a swap happened.

Reach is deliberately narrow. phraser.swap_models is an exact-match
allowlist of absolute paths a human wrote, rejected at startup otherwise,
so "swap the model" can never mean "load any file on my disk"; the running
model is always swappable back to. MethodSwapModel is AuthStepUp, the same
rung as mutating the tool allowlist, and /models gates POST through the
same stepUpOK the tools page uses. Nothing calls Swap on a timer and no
act, intent or utterance reaches it.

// Package main is mavend — maven's daemon.
//
// "core = the only key-holder": one process holds the unlocked store + the
// trigger loop; modules are separate processes, key-free, fail-independent.
// the daemon wires Store → Gatherer → Tick → phraser → delivery, runs the 60s
// ticker, owns the cold-start unlock dance, and exposes the CoreAPI boundary
// over a unix socket for modules (router/delivery/poller/...) to call.
//
// Floor (this file): pluggable seams wired with the deterministic Stubs.
// - phraser Stub (no LLM)
// - voice sink wired via wireVoice: embedder/classifier seeded with ~10
// examples across 5 intents; stt + tts stubs in-process by default,
// remote module sockets when configured; TCP listener on voice.bind.
// The voice sink (voicesink.Sink via Sessions) is wired into the
// dispatcher — the reactive path (push-to-talk) AND proactive nudges
// (care-when-present, sev3/sev4 present) both route through the same
// stt→router→tts→client pipeline.
// - auth FloorEnrollment + nil Session — cold-start unlock assumed: today
// the store opens plain sqlite (sqlcipher deferred). the daemon runs
// "unlocked" — the locked-until-asserted dance lands with the Session
// verifier + ask-password transport (open spec item).
//
// Cold-start unlock (2026-07-06):
//
// When a passkey credential is enrolled AND no env key is set, the daemon
// starts in LOCKED mode: the IPC server runs but rejects all store methods
// except MethodAssertStepUp and MethodUnlock. A passkey assertion followed
// by MethodUnlock (with the same credential's public key) unwraps the at-rest
// AES-256 key from a wrapped blob on disk (HKDF-SHA256 + AES-GCM) and opens
// the encrypted store. After unlock, the daemon wires voice, loop, and
// delivery and runs normally.
//
// Fallback: when db_key_env is set (or no wrapped file exists), the daemon
// starts unlocked from the env key (pre-unlock behavior). Enrolling a passkey
// while unlocked calls MethodStoreEncryptionKey to wrap the env key and
// persist the wrapped blob — enabling cold-start unlock on the next boot
// after the env key is removed.
